Rickie Fowler makes career-high nine birdies in final round of Quicken Loans National

Rickie Fowler was on fire Sunday from TPC Potomac.

Fowler, who entered the final round of the Quicken Loans National at even par, went to 1-over early on after a bogey on the fourth hole. 

Then Fowler rallied, sinking six birdies in a seven hole span, climbing the Quicken Loans National leaderboard. Fowler began his attack on the par-4 seventh, with just a bogey on 11 sandwiched between the six birdies. 

After a double-bogey ended the birdie run, Fowler answered with two more birdies in the last four holes, including ending his 72nd hole of the weekend one-under par.
